#939872 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#939872 is composed of 57.6% red, 59.6%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 25%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 67.9 degrees, a saturation of 15.6% and a lightness of 52.2%. #939872 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e4 with #273100. Closest websafe color is: #999966.

● #939872 color description : Dark grayish yellow.
#939872 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#939872 has RGB values of R:147, G:152, B:114 and CMYK values of C:0.03, M:0, Y:0.25,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 9672818.

Shades and Tints of #939872
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060605 is the darkest color, while #fbfbfa is the lightest one.
